Gdje se refleksija koristi u Javi?
Gdje se refleksija koristi u Javi?

Video: Gdje se refleksija koristi u Javi?

Video: Gdje se refleksija koristi u Javi?
Video: Моя работа наблюдать за лесом и здесь происходит что-то странное 2024, Maj
Anonim

Uzima bilo koji objekat kao parametar i koristi Java refleksija API za ispis svakog imena polja i vrijednosti. Refleksija je uobičajeno korišteno programima koji zahtijevaju mogućnost ispitivanja ili modifikacije ponašanja aplikacija koje se izvode u toku Java virtuelna mašina.

Isto tako, ljudi se pitaju, gdje se koristi refleksija?

Jedna korisna upotreba u stvarnom svijetu refleksija je kada se piše okvir koji mora interoperirati s korisnički definiranim klasama, gdje autor okvira ne zna koji će članovi (ili čak klase) biti. Refleksija omogućava im da se bave bilo kojom klasom, a da to ne znaju unaprijed.

je isti program refleksije u Javi? Java Reflection je proces ispitivanja ili modifikacije ponašanja klase u vremenu izvođenja. The java . lang. Klasa klase pruža mnoge metode koje se mogu koristiti za dobivanje metapodataka, ispitivanje i promjenu ponašanja klase u vremenu izvođenja.

Prema tome, da li je korištenje refleksije loše u Javi?

Ima dobrih poena Refleksija . Nije sve loše kada se pravilno koristi; omogućava nam da iskoristimo API-je unutar Androida i također Java . To će omogućiti programerima da budu još kreativniji s našim aplikacijama. Postoje biblioteke i okviri koji koristite Reflection ; savršeno dobar primjer je JUnit.

Šta je softver Reflection?

U informatici, refleksija je sposobnost procesa da ispita, introspekuje i modifikuje sopstvenu strukturu i ponašanje.

Preporučuje se: